Upon completion of the Trader Trainee programme, you will be prepared for the expectations and responsibilities of a Bunker and Lubricant Trader. If you are successful in the programme, you will be offered a full-time position in one of our affiliated offices worldwide and furthermore will have the option to relocate. WORKING AT GLANDER INTERNATIONAL BUNKERING We at Glander International Bunkering make education a priority and ensure our Trader Trainees receive a thorough understanding of the fundamental concepts of the bunker industry. Back to back trading Establish new accounts (cold calling) Follow up on enquiries New customer outlook and initiate contact Maintain and nurture a stable customer portfolio Understand customer needs, negotiate price and close deals Coordinate with local ports and supply agents to manage delivery The ideal candidate You have completed your upper secondary education Speak, read and write English fluently, preferably also Spanish Self-starter and team-oriented Strong attention to detail in day-to-day tasking Desire to travel and work independently Want to join the team?
